The Klang High Court has sentenced a former mechanic to 32 years in prison and 12 strokes of the cane after he was found guilty of murdering his girlfriend in August 2022.

The accused was previously sentenced to seven years in prison under Section 304(b) of the Penal Code on 17 October last year.

Man smothered his girlfriend after he refused to sign no-breakup agreement

The decision was made by Judge Norliza Othman after the prosecution successfully proved its case beyond a reasonable doubt against the 23-year-old accused at the end of the defence case, according to Berita Harian.

Amirul Amin Amirruddin was charged under Section 302 of the Penal Code for murdering 24-year-old Nurul Shahira Abdullah at a house in Lorong Haji Mahat, Kampung Sri Pandan, Klang at 7:18 PM. He was accused of smothering her with a pillow following an argument after he refused to sign an agreement promising not to leave her.

The post-mortem report, as confirmed by a prosecution pathologist, found that the victim died from suffocation after being smothered with a pillow.

“During cross-examination, the accused admitted that while smothering the deceased’s face, he saw her breathing slowly and struggling. He said he did so to stop her aggressive behaviour.

“The accused also knew that his actions could cause the deceased to be unable to breathe, as her entire face was covered with a pillow and humans breathe through the nose. He only stopped after he realised the victim was no longer resisting and had stopped breathing,” Judge Norliza added.

 

“There were other ways to calm the deceased besides using a pillow”

Norliza said the accused’s sworn defence in the witness box was merely a denial.

She added that during cross-examination, the accused also agreed with the prosecution that there were other ways to calm the deceased besides using a pillow.

“The court found no element of extreme provocation that would have caused the accused to act in such a manner. He had sufficient time to consider a more rational response and to calm the deceased when he refused to sign the agreement,” she said.

The sentence was ordered to run from the date of arrest on 24 August 2022.
